Spend the extra $25 Bucks and go to Philly!

I was very excited to have a Brazilian steakhouse here in the Valley, since we are big fans of Fogo de Chao in Philly and Churrascarria in NYC. I had checked out about it online and called 2 weeks in a row to get a reservation on a Saturday night. The first Saturday they were completely booked and the next Saturday, I had to wait till 8 pm to get a small table for 2 in the middle of the dining room.

Again, we are both very familiar with Brazilian steakhouses, and the only reason that you go there is meat, meat, and more meat. I am guessing that we couldn’t get a reservation based on the fact that this place is new and people around the area have never seen anything like this before. Please trust me, it is NOT good!

When we got there we were greeted by a server (who just brings you drinks and fills your sides of fries and fried bananas) and he didn’t do that very well. I was slightly worried when the waiter told us that it was only $23 per person since we have never paid less the $55 per person, but I figured since it was Nazareth and they wanted to draw a crowd they were leaving their prices low.

We flipped our little discs to the green side (which means that the waiters with skewers of meat start bring options to your table) and started eating.

The meat was BAD!! There were not that many choices (they told us that there were 16, but I couldn’t have counted more then about 10, and there was barely any beef! If you have been to a Brazilian restaurant before you know that the best thing cooked over that open fire is beef, and their specialty is to Top Sirloin…but not at Rios.

If you are a “meatatarian” like we are then you honestly need to spend the extra $25 per person and drive to Philly or New York and go to a REAL Brazilian steakhouse. Just because you have an open fire pit and some men walking around with meat skewers DOESNT make you a Brazilian Steakhouse…Someone should let Rios know that!!
